For the finale of this season of The Voice, the NBC singing competition recruited a handful of guest acts to perform.

Among the night's performers were Coldplay, Ed Sheeran, OneRepublic, Tim McGraw and more. Robin Thicke also apparently didn't "Get Her Back," so he performed the plea for a second time this week, once again putting his marital troubles in the public eye.

Sheeran joined forces with finalist and pre-Voice YouTube sensation Christina Grimmie to perform the former's "All of the Stars," from the newly releasedThe Fault in Our Stars soundtrack.
